Friday Night Track League 7th August

Post by AdeR » 09 Aug 2015 19:00

A still and warm night and some good racing. In the 10 lap scratch Phil Farley mixed things up really effectively; launching two attacks in the early stages of the race. I got away a bit later with one of the Halesowen young riders - only to have the break chased down by the men in purple! It all came together for a bunch sprint where I got 3rd. The next race was an alteration to the programme due to the small number of A cats. We had an all in unknown distance race. I was 2nd Vet and Phil was 2nd B cat non vet. Again in a change to the programme we had an a and B cat devil. I was really pleased with this performance as this is not my favourite race at all. The presence of A cat riders lifted the pace and made for safer racing. I was really pleased to get 5th overall (2nd B cat) after being forced to readjust my normal strategy of time trialling on the front in the sprinters lane. In the 40 lap scratch I take my hat off to Matthew Harris who gained a lap with the As then still took the B group sprint. I got 2nd and Phil got 4th. A decent points haul.
